repo.or.cz
/
glibc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
libio: Convert __vsprintf_internal to buffers
2022-12-19
Flo
r
ian W
e
imer
libio: Convert __vspr
i
ntf_internal to buf
f
er
s
commit
|
commitdiff
|
tree
2022-12-19
Fl
o
r
ian Weimer
stdio-c
o
mmon: Add lock optimization to vfprintf
and
.
.
.
commit
|
commitdiff
|
tree
2022-12-19
F
l
orian Weimer
stdio-common: Convert vfprintf and
rela
t
e
d f
u
nc
t
ions
.
.
.
commit
|
commitdiff
|
tree
2022-12-19
F
l
o
rian Weimer
stdio-common
:
A
d
d __t
r
an
s
lated_number_wid
t
h
commit
|
commitdiff
|
tree
2022-12-19
Flo
r
i
a
n Weimer
stdio-c
o
m
mon: Add __printf_funct
i
on_i
n
voke
commit
|
commitdiff
|
tree
2022-12-19
Flo
r
ian Weimer
s
t
dio-common
:
Intro
d
uce buffers for i
m
plementin
g
p
rintf
commit
|
commitdiff
|
tree
2022-12-19
F
lori
a
n
Weimer
locale: Implem
e
nt stru
c
t
grouping_ite
r
ator
commit
|
commitdiff
|
tree
2022-12-19
Florian Weim
e
r
Linux: R
e
m
o
ve epoll_create, inotify_init from sy
s
c
al
l
s
.
.
.
commit
|
commitdiff
|
tree
2022-12-19
Florian Weimer
Linux: Reflow and sort some Makefile v
a
r
i
ables
commit
|
commitdiff
|
tree
2022-11-10
Floria
n
We
i
mer
Linux:
S
uppo
r
t __
I
PC_64 in sysvctl *ctl
c
om
m
and arg
u
men
t
s
.
.
.
commit
|
commitdiff
|
tree
2022-11-09
наб
iconvda
t
a/ts
t
-table-charmap
.
sh: remove
h
andling of
.
.
.
Reviewed-by: Florian Weimer <
fweimer@redhat.com
>
commit
|
commitdiff
|
tree
2022-11-04
Florian Weimer
elf:
Disable
s
o
me subtests of i
f
uncmain1, ifuncmai
n
5
.
.
.
commit
|
commitdiff
|
tree
2022-11-04
Florian Weimer
posix: M
a
ke
p
osix_spa
w
n exten
s
ions availabl
e
b
y defa
u
l
t
commit
|
commitdiff
|
tree
2022-11-03
Florian Weimer
elf:
Introd
u
ce <
d
l-call_tls_init_tp
.
h> and ca
l
l_tls_init_tp
.
.
.
commit
|
commitdiff
|
tree
2022-11-03
Florian We
i
mer
scripts/glibcelf
.
py: Properly report <elf
.
h> parsing
.
.
.
commit
|
commitdiff
|
tree
2022-11-03
F
l
orian Weimer
elf: Rework exce
p
t
i
on handling in th
e
dyna
m
ic loader
.
.
.
commit
|
commitdiff
|
tree
2022-10-27
Fl
o
rian
W
eimer
elf: Intro
d
uce to _d
l
_call_f
i
n
i
commit
|
commitdiff
|
tree
2022-10-27
F
l
orian Weime
r
ld
.
so: Export tls_
i
nit_tp_called
as
__
r
tld_tls_init_tp_called
commit
|
commitdiff
|
tree
2022-10-27
Flo
r
ian Weimer
scrip
t
s/local
p
l
t
.
a
w
k
:
Handle DT_JMPREL with empty PLT
.
.
.
commit
|
commitdiff
|
tree
2022-10-25
Jakub Wilk
manual: Add missing % in
i
nt conversion list
commit
|
commitdiff
|
tree
2022-10-18
Flo
r
ian Weimer
Use
PTR_MANGLE and PTR_
D
EMANGLE
u
ncon
d
i
t
i
ona
l
ly in
.
.
.
commit
|
commitdiff
|
tree
2022-10-18
Florian
W
e
imer
Intro
d
u
ce
<
p
ointer_guard
.
h>, extracted from
<sysdep
.
h>
commit
|
commitdiff
|
tree
2022-10-18
Florian
Weimer
x86-64: Move LP_SIZE
de
f
inition
t
o its own header
commit
|
commitdiff
|
tree
2022-10-14
Florian
Weimer
elf: Do
n
o
t co
m
pletely
c
lear reused namespace
in dlmopen
.
.
.
commit
|
commitdiff
|
tree
2022-10-13
Flori
a
n Weimer
malloc
:
Swi
t
ch global_max_fast
to uint8_t
commit
|
commitdiff
|
tree
2022-09-23
Florian Weimer
n
s
s: Use shared prefix in IPv4 address
in tst-reload1
commit
|
commitdiff
|
tree
2022-09-23
Fl
o
rian Weimer
nss: Enhance tst-reload1
c
o
v
erage a
n
d lo
g
ging
commit
|
commitdiff
|
tree
2022-09-22
Flori
a
n
W
eimer
elf: Extract glibcelf
co
n
st
a
nts
f
rom <elf
.
h>
commit
|
commitdiff
|
tree
2022-09-22
Florian Weimer
scripts:
E
nhance glibcpp to
do
basic
m
acro processing
commit
|
commitdiff
|
tree
2022-09-22
Flor
i
a
n
Weimer
scripts: E
x
tract
g
libcpp
.
py f
r
om check-obsolete-constructs
.
py
commit
|
commitdiff
|
tree
2022-09-20
F
l
orian Weimer
nss: Fix tst-
n
ss-files
-
hosts-lon
g
on
s
ingle-sta
c
k hosts
.
.
.
commit
|
commitdiff
|
tree
2022-09-20
F
l
orian Weimer
nss
:
I
mplement --no-addrconfig option
for getent
commit
|
commitdiff
|
tree
2022-09-20
Florian
W
eimer
gconv: Use 64-
b
it interfa
c
es in gconv_parseconfdi
r
.
.
.
commit
|
commitdiff
|
tree
2022-09-20
Florian Weimer
e
l
f: I
m
plement force_first handl
i
ng
i
n
_dl_sort_maps_
d
fs
.
.
.
commit
|
commitdiff
|
tree
2022-09-19
Florian
W
e
i
m
er
Linux: D
o
not skip d_ino ==
0 entri
e
s in readd
i
r, readdir64
.
.
.
commit
|
commitdiff
|
tree
2022-09-08
Javi
e
r Pello
elf:
F
ix hwcaps s
t
r
i
n
g size ove
r
estimation
commit
|
commitdiff
|
tree
2022-09-06
F
l
o
r
ian Weimer
e
lf: Rename _
d
l
_sort_maps paramet
e
r from sk
i
p t
o
f
orce_first
commit
|
commitdiff
|
tree
2022-09-06
F
lorian Weimer
scripts/dso-ordering-tes
t
.
p
y: Ge
n
e
rate prog
r
am run
.
.
.
commit
|
commitdiff
|
tree
2022-09-05
Florian Weimer
sc
r
ipts/
b
uild-many
-
glib
c
s
.
py: Use https:/
/
f
or so
u
rceware
.
.
.
commit
|
commitdiff
|
tree
2022-09-05
Flor
i
an Wei
m
e
r
elf
.
h
:
Remove
d
uplicate definitio
n
of VE
R
_FLG_WEAK
commit
|
commitdiff
|
tree
2022-08-30
Flo
r
ian Weimer
resol
v
: Fix buildi
n
g tst-resolv-i
n
valid-cname
for earlie
r
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
Flor
i
an Weimer
nss_
d
ns: R
e
write
_
nss_dns_geth
o
stbyname4_r u
s
i
ng c
u
r
r
e
nt
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
Flo
r
ian
W
e
i
me
r
res
o
lv:
A
dd new t
s
t-reso
l
v
-
inva
l
id-cname
commit
|
commitdiff
|
tree
2022-08-30
Florian
Weimer
nss_dns: In ga
i
h_getanswer
_
s
lice
,
s
k
ip stran
g
e a
l
iases
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
F
l
orian Weime
r
nss_dns: Rewrit
e
getanswer
_
r to match getanswer_ptr
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
Fl
o
rian
Weimer
n
s
s_dns: Rem
o
ve remna
n
ts of IPv6 addr
e
ss mapping
commit
|
commitdiff
|
tree
2022-08-30
F
l
orian Weimer
n
ss_dns: Rewrit
e
_nss_dns_ge
t
hostb
y
ad
d
r2_r and get
a
nswer_p
t
r
commit
|
commitdiff
|
tree
2022-08-30
Floria
n
We
i
mer
n
ss_dns: Split g
e
tan
s
wer_pt
r
from getans
w
er_r
commit
|
commitdiff
|
tree
2022-08-30
Florian Wei
m
er
resolv: Add D
N
S pa
c
ket parsing helpers ge
a
r
e
d towards
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
Florian Weimer
resolv: Ad
d
i
n
t
ernal
__ns_name_length_
u
ncompressed
.
.
.
commit
|
commitdiff
|
tree
2022-08-30
Florian
Weimer
r
e
solv: Add
t
he _
_
ns_
s
amebinaryname function
commit
|
commitdiff
|
tree
2022-08-30
Florian Weimer
re
s
ol
v
: Add int
e
rnal __res
_
bin
a
ry_hnok functio
n
commit
|
commitdiff
|
tree
2022-08-30
Florian Wei
m
er
resolv: Add
t
st-reso
l
v-alias
e
s
commit
|
commitdiff
|
tree
2022-08-30
Fl
o
ria
n
Wei
m
er
resolv:
Add tst-
r
esolv-byadd
r
for testing re
v
ers
e
lookup
commit
|
commitdiff
|
tree
2022-08-26
F
lorian We
i
mer
elf: Cal
l
__libc_ear
l
y_init for
r
eu
s
ed namespaces
.
.
.
commit
|
commitdiff
|
tree
2022-08-25
Florian We
i
mer
s390: Move
h
w
c
a
ps/platform names out of
_rtld
_
gl
o
bal_ro
commit
|
commitdiff
|
tree
2022-08-25
Fl
o
rian Weimer
Rever
t
"Dete
c
t ld
.
so
and libc
.
so version inconsis
t
ency
.
.
.
commit
|
commitdiff
|
tree
2022-08-24
Fl
o
rian Weimer
Detect ld
.
so and libc
.
so version incon
s
i
stency du
r
ing
.
.
.
commit
|
commitdiff
|
tree
2022-08-23
Florian Weimer
scripts/glibcelf
.
py
:
Add hashing suppo
r
t
commit
|
commitdiff
|
tree
2022-08-22
Florian W
e
imer
alpha: Fix g
e
ne
r
ic brk system call emulation in
__brk_call
.
.
.
commit
|
commitdiff
|
tree
2022-08-17
Flor
i
a
n
W
eim
e
r
localedata: Convert French language locales
(fr_*)
.
.
.
commit
|
commitdiff
|
tree
2022-08-16
Florian Weimer
Linux:
F
ix en
u
m
f
sconfig_command detection in <s
y
s
.
.
.
commit
|
commitdiff
|
tree
2022-08-16
Flor
i
a
n
Weim
e
r
elf: Run tst-audit-tl
s
desc, t
s
t
-audit-tlsdesc-dlopen
.
.
.
commit
|
commitdiff
|
tree
2022-08-15
Florian Weimer
m
a
lloc:
Do
n
ot use M
A
P_NOR
E
SE
R
V
E t
o
a
l
l
oc
a
te heap s
e
g
ments
commit
|
commitdiff
|
tree
2022-08-15
Floria
n
Weime
r
Linu
x
: Terminate subproces
s
on late fa
i
l
u
r
e in tst
.
.
.
commit
|
commitdiff
|
tree
2022-08-10
Flor
i
an We
i
mer
inet
:
Turn
__ivaliduser into a co
m
p
a
t
i
bility
s
y
mbol
commit
|
commitdiff
|
tree
2022-08-04
Florian We
i
mer
dl
f
cn: Pass caller pointer t
o
static dlopen implemen
t
ation
.
.
.
commit
|
commitdiff
|
tree
2022-08-04
Flo
r
ian Wei
m
er
mall
o
c
: Corre
c
t the documentation
o
f
th
e
top_pad
d
e
fault
commit
|
commitdiff
|
tree
2022-08-04
Florian Weimer
Linux: Remove exit sy
s
t
e
m call f
r
om _exit
commit
|
commitdiff
|
tree
2022-08-03
Florian We
i
me
r
as
s
ert: Do not us
e
stde
r
r in libc
-
int
e
r
n
al assert
commit
|
commitdiff
|
tree
2022-08-03
Flor
i
an Weimer
nptl
:
Remove uses of asse
r
t_
p
e
r
ror
commit
|
commitdiff
|
tree
2022-08-03
Flori
a
n Wei
m
er
s
t
dio: Clean up _
_
libc_message after unconditi
o
n
al
.
.
.
commit
|
commitdiff
|
tree
2022-08-01
Florian Weimer
malloc
:
Use _
_
getrandom_
n
ocancel during tcache
i
nitiailization
commit
|
commitdiff
|
tree
2022-08-01
Florian Weime
r
Remove spurio
u
s ref
e
rences
to _dl_o
p
en_ho
o
k
commit
|
commitdiff
|
tree
2022-07-25
F
lorian
Weimer
Linux: dirent/tst-readdi
r
64
-
compat n
e
eds t
o
us
e
TEST_COM
P
A
T
.
.
.
commit
|
commitdiff
|
tree
2022-07-21
Florian Weimer
m
alloc: Simplify
i
mplementation
o
f
__ma
l
l
o
c_assert
commit
|
commitdiff
|
tree
2022-07-08
F
l
o
ri
a
n Weimer
elf: Renam
e
tst-au
d
it26
to tst-audi
t
28
commit
|
commitdiff
|
tree
2022-07-05
Fl
o
ri
a
n Weimer
elf: Fix direction of NODE
L
ETE lo
g
me
s
s
a
ges dur
i
ng
.
.
.
commit
|
commitdiff
|
tree
2022-07-05
Fl
o
ria
n
Weime
r
m
a
l
l
o
c: Simpli
f
y che
c
k
ed_req
u
est
2
s
ize
i
nt
e
rface
commit
|
commitdiff
|
tree
2022-07-05
Fl
o
ri
a
n
Weimer
stdlib
:
S
i
mplify buffer
ma
n
agement in cano
n
i
c
a
lize
commit
|
commitdiff
|
tree
2022-07-05
Flo
r
i
an Weimer
locale
d
ef: Support bui
l
di
n
g fo
r
o
l
der C standa
r
ds
commit
|
commitdiff
|
tree
2022-07-05
Fl
o
rian We
i
mer
d
e_DE: Convert to UTF-
8
commit
|
commitdiff
|
tree
2022-07-05
Florian Weimer
locale: localdef
input files are now encoded in UTF-8
commit
|
commitdiff
|
tree
2022-07-05
Floria
n
Weimer
l
o
cale: Introduce translate_unicode_code
p
oint into
.
.
.
commit
|
commitdiff
|
tree
2022-07-05
Florian Weimer
locale: Fix signed char bug
i
n l
r
_getc
commit
|
commitdiff
|
tree
2022-07-05
Florian Weimer
local
e
: Turn ADD
C
and
A
DDS
into functions
in l
i
n
e
r
eader
.
c
commit
|
commitdiff
|
tree
2022-07-04
Guilherme
J
anczak
a
r
g
p
:
R
e
m
ove old i
n
c
ludes
i
n
!_LIBC
case
commit
|
commitdiff
|
tree
2022-06-29
Flor
i
an We
i
mer
Linux: Forward declaration
of str
u
ct iove
c
for process_madvise
commit
|
commitdiff
|
tree
2022-06-28
Florian Weimer
elf: F
i
x -DNDEBUG warni
n
g in _dl_start_args_adjust
commit
|
commitdiff
|
tree
2022-06-28
Yang Yanchao
elf:
Fix comp
i
le error with
-
Werror and -DNDEBUG
commit
|
commitdiff
|
tree
2022-06-24
Florian W
e
imer
reso
l
v/tst-res
o
lv-noaaaa:
Support buildin
g
for
o
lder
.
.
.
commit
|
commitdiff
|
tree
2022-06-24
Florian We
i
mer
res
o
lv:
I
mplement no-
a
aaa
s
t
u
b resolver option
commit
|
commitdiff
|
tree
2022-06-24
Florian Weimer
support: Change non-address
o
u
t
p
u
t
f
ormat of
suppor
t
_format_
.
.
.
commit
|
commitdiff
|
tree
2022-06-02
Flo
r
ian Weimer
t
e
st
r
un
.
s
h:
Support passing strace and valgrind arg
u
men
t
s
commit
|
commitdiff
|
tree
2022-06-02
Florian Weime
r
Linux: Adjust stru
c
t
rseq defini
t
i
on to current
kernel
.
.
.
commit
|
commitdiff
|
tree
2022-05-24
Floria
n
Weimer
stdio-commo
n
: Simplify
printf_unknown interface in
.
.
.
commit
|
commitdiff
|
tree
2022-05-24
Florian Weimer
s
tdio-
c
ommon
:
Move un
i
on
p
rintf_arg int <pri
n
tf
.
h>
commit
|
commitdiff
|
tree
2022-05-24
Florian
We
i
mer
std
i
o-common: Add prin
t
f
s
pecifier registry to <printf
.
h>
commit
|
commitdiff
|
tree
2022-05-23
Florian Weimer
locale: Add
more
c
ach
e
d data to L
C
_CTYPE
commit
|
commitdiff
|
tree
2022-05-23
Florian
W
eimer
locale: Remove pri
v
ate
u
nio
n
from struct __loc
a
le_data
commit
|
commitdiff
|
tree
next